## Deployment

This release of Wirestitch addresses the reconnect loop in the websocket gateway, where stale session tokens were replayed after a dropped connection, briefly extending an expired session's lifetime. The fix invalidates tokens server-side on disconnect and forces a full handshake on reconnect. Deploy gateway nodes one at a time and confirm the handshake counter rises in the audit feed before proceeding. Each node must be started with the hardened configuration values listed below.

service settings:
[casax]
port = 6379
team = rusir
host = casax.zemvarhq.corp
region = outer-4
access_code = ac_9808ce
timeout_ms = 1500

Finance Review Summary — Branch Managers, Callowmere Retail

The Brisket & Bloom houseware line retires end of Q4. Margins fell below threshold three consecutive quarters. Remaining stock discounted 30%, no reorders. Shelf space reallocates to the Fernway range. Write-down booked this quarter; branch P&L impact is minor. Staff redeployment handled locally. Strategic follow-on detail is set out in the confidential note below.

board note of bawep-tajef: Queniusek Systems plans to raise the Quenvan list price by 53.1 percent in March. The pricing group signed off on a budget of $176.4 million for Project Drueth. The renewal with Casionix Partners closes at $142.5 million a year, 8.3 percent below the last contract. Project Fraax slips by six weeks because of the tooling delay.

The garage occupancy feed for the Brindlewood campus arrives over a message queue every thirty seconds, one record per level, published by the Stallgrid edge boxes. Counts can briefly go negative when a sensor double-fires on exit; the ingest job clamps these to zero and flags the interval. If the feed stalls for more than five minutes, the dashboard falls back to the last known snapshot. Sensor mappings, queue names, and the replay procedure are documented on the internal page below.

runbook for tahog-kadug: https://gitlab.qirvanworks.corp/projects/pages/view/b139298aed28